How to Program a BMW Key

BMWs come with an advanced security system that verifies that the signal from the key fob can be detected prior to allowing entry into the vehicle. However, some criminals still make use of a signal amplifier to clone the key fob and gain entry into your vehicle.

Losing keys can be costly and frustrating. There are several options to avoid the hassles of a stolen or lost BMW key.

How to program a bmw key

It's simple to program a new BMW key fob. If you're looking to replace your old one or add another driver to your Portland family it takes only minutes. The steps needed to pair the new key fob to your vehicle are the same as ones used for older BMW models that make use of the actual physical key. The only difference is that you will need to replace the battery on the key fob with a CR2032 battery that can be found at local hardware stores and our parts department.

Close all windows and doors if you have a functional BMW key fob. Then insert the working key into the ignition and turn it to position one. You will see the dashboard lights and the accessories come on but the engine will not engage. Turn the key until it is in zero position and then remove it. Repeat this process for any additional key fobs that you want to add to your vehicle. If you're adding a key fob you've never programmed previously make sure you do it within 30 seconds of the initial key programming.

Once you've inserted the new key into the lock, press and hold the unlock button (the one with the BMW logo) down. Press it three times quickly and then release your finger from the button. If you've done this correctly, the doors will automatically unlock and lock when you release the unlock button.

This method can be used to program a key fob from the beginning. This is useful if you are replacing an old one or you just purchased a second hand BMW car. Insert the existing key in the ignition and then move it to position 1 to do this. The dash and accessory lights should be lit however the engine won't start. After that, insert the new key fob and push the unlock button down (the BMW logo) three times in a row before release it.

How to replace a BMW key

Whether you need to replace the BMW's key fob or want to sync an upgraded one to your vehicle the process is easy. It is usually possible to do it yourself without having to go to the dealer. The first step is to confirm that the new key fob works with your vehicle. If it is, you can follow the directions in the BMW Digital Key app to complete the process of setting it up. Once the key fob is activated, it can be used to unlock and start your BMW.

The smart key on the latest BMW models can be connected with your smartphone to open and shut off the car. This lets you add multiple drivers, which is particularly useful if you have children or other family members who frequently drive your BMW. You can also set limits on the key, like speed limits and audio presets.

It is essential to store your new key fob safely once you've paired it. Your BMW key fob is designed to be secure. It will only unlock your car when it receives the appropriate signal for identification. This feature makes hacking or replicating your BMW key fob almost impossible.

The BMW Display Key with touchscreen is the most modern BMW key fob, and it's available for many of the brand's premium vehicles. This key fob has more features than the standard key fob, including a full-color touchscreen. However, it's not water resistant like a standard key fob, and you should treat it with diligence.

It could be time to replace the battery if your BMW key fob has slow response or is not responding. These advanced keys are powered by a tiny rechargeable battery that will wear out over time with regular use. To replace the battery, you'll require an instrument of a smaller size, like a screwdriver. Then, you'll need to remove the valet key and reveal the small access port. After that, you can add an additional CR2032 battery and then put the valet key back in place.

How to share a bmw key

The BMW Digital Key lets drivers use their mobile phones as get more info remote keys to their car. The app can unlock and start the car, as well as create driving restrictions. The app is compatible with all modern BMW models. Older models may require an upgrade to function correctly. Contact your BMW center for help.

To share the BMW Digital Key, the owner must sign in to their BMW Connected Drive account and select "Manage Access" from the menu. They can then invite a guest via email. Once the invitation is accepted the guest will receive instructions on how to connect their phone with the vehicle. The person must possess an appropriate iPhone, Apple Watch, or iPad, and they must have the latest version of the BMW Connected app. The user can also authenticate using fingerprints or a passkey within the BMW app.

It's now easier than ever before to share the BMW Digital Key. The BMW Connected app now comes with an entire section dedicated to sharing keys. The owner can simply send a link to the person who will receive it via email or a messaging app such as WhatsApp. The recipient can click on the link and then add the Digital Key into their wallet. This is a significant advancement for BMW as it allows sharing keys even when the recipient doesn't have a BMW Connected Drive account or an Android smartphone.

The BMW Digital Key is not just convenient, it is also secure. The key functions are saved in the Secure Element of the phone and can only be activated if the phone is close to the vehicle. The essential functions are virtually impossible to hack or spoof.

How to revoke a bmw key

The BMW key has played an important part in driving and car ownership for a number of years. It is a convenient way to lock and start your car. However technology has altered the way things work. BMW offers a digital car key that lets you control your vehicle using your smartphone. The key can be used to unlock your car, start it, turn on the ignition, and even park your car from a distance. It can also switch on your air conditioning and change the radio station, and much more.

A digital key allows users to share access with up to five family members or friends according to the degree of access you decide to grant. You can deactivate the access of any Digital Key at any time by tapping on the name of the recipient in the iDrive menu. The vehicle has to be in standby mode and not be in the driving position for the revocation to take place.
